Nokia introduced a clamshell phone with Google services – more RAM than some smartphones

Nokia continues to release feature phones – a cross between modern smartphones and conventional cell phones. In this segment, something rarely goes beyond the standard, but the new Nokia 2780 Flip turned out to be quite unusual.

The novelty is made in a clamshell form factor and is equipped with two displays: the main internal 2.7 inches and an additional external 1.77 inches. Attention is drawn to the KaiOS 3.1 operating system, thanks to which the feature phone received some Google services, including YouTube and Google Maps. The Nokia 2780 Flip uses a typical Qualcomm 215 processor for this segment, but at the same time as much as 4 GB of RAM – now not all budget smartphones are equipped with this amount of RAM.

Nokia 2780 Flip is very similar to 2760 Flip – the key innovation is the introduction of FM radio. The novelty will go on sale on November 15, the price in the US is $90.
